Otago Lakes Police seeking owner of vehicle



Otago Lakes Central Police are trying to identify an owner for this vehicle, which was recovered earlier this month when a number of people using it were arrested in relation to a burglary in Palmerston, Central Otago.

An examination of the vehicle has identified that the engine number has been partially destroyed, while the Vehicle identification Number (VIN) appears to have been cut out and replaced with a legitimate vehicle identity plate.

Detective Alan Lee of the Wanaka Police says an assessment of all reported unlawful takings of Toyota Hiluxes across the South Island since January 2015 has been unsuccessful in identifying an occurrence that matched this vehicle, and Police is seeking the help of the public with finding an owner.

An expert has identified the body as a Toyota Hilux from between 1996–2003, and while the wheels are a distinctive addition, it is not known when they were placed on the vehicle.

“Someone will recognise this vehicle, and we would like to hear from anyone who may be able to assist us with reuniting it with its rightful owner,” Detective Lee said.
